How Completing the Square Inside Each Square Root Actually Works
At its core, completing the square inside a square root transforms a raw, often unwieldy expression into a simpler, standardized form. For example, within a square root expression like √(x² + 6x + 9), recognizing the perfect square trinomial (x + 3)² reveals hidden structure. This process involves identifying the constant needed to form a binomial square—(b/2)²—then adjusting the expression accordingly.
